Your intelligent assistant for Ethiopian legal research.
The legal landscape in Ethiopia is constantly evolving, making it difficult for anyone to stay updated on the latest proclamations and cassation rulings. Negarit solves this with a 100% AI-based research tool powered by a vast, ever-expanding database. By automating the search across a massive corpus of laws, it provides students, citizens, and lawyers with instant, accurate answers from a source that never goes out of date.

AI powered mobile pos for Ethiopian restaurants
Currently, 90% of Ethiopian restaurants rely on outdated legacy systems or manual pen-and-paper because modern hardware is too expensive. This causes slow table turnover, lost revenue, and major language barriers between front-of-house staff and the kitchen. TableTap solves this by operating entirely in the cloud. It is a 100% hardware-free order management platform where waitstaff use their own smartphones to process orders in native Amharic. These commands are instantly sent to a digital Kitchen Display System, effectively acting as an autonomous digital employee that speeds up service and eliminates order errors without the need for a single piece of proprietary hardware.

Authorization engine for AI agents: allow, deny, route to a human, or reroute safely — catching prompt injection too.
The problem: Giving AI agents real tool access (delete records, move money, send messages, deploy code) means trusting them with a blank check. Traditional authorization — OPA, Casbin, AWS Verified Permissions, Okta — only answers "is this agent allowed to do X?" They can't catch the dangerous case: a legitimately authorized agent that's been manipulated into doing the wrong thing — through prompt injection in the data it's processing, a low-confidence/hallucinated decision, or anomalous behavior. "Authorized but wrong" is exactly the failure mode that makes agent autonomy risky in production. How Lelu solves it: Every agent action flows through one authorization call that returns one of four outcomes instead of just allow/deny: allow — proceed deny — blocked human_review — pause, a human approves, the agent resumes compute — reroute to a safer/sandboxed alternative Behind that call is a layered pipeline: a prompt-injection filter → a confidence gate (using verified LLM token log-probs where available, failing closed when they aren't) → policy evaluation (YAML or OPA/Rego) → a risk score (criticality × (1 − confidence) × reliability × anomaly_factor) → a most-restrictive-wins merge so any single layer can only make a decision stricter, never looser → an audit log of every decision. Around it sits agent identity (RS256 workload JWTs / OIDC), an MCP OAuth 2.1 server, and an encrypted OAuth token vault. The result: every action is checked, every decision is logged, and a human is pulled in exactly when it matters — without changing how you build the agent (one SDK call).

A startup validation & regulatory roadmap platform tailored for founders in the Ethiopian startup ecosystem.
Building a startup in Ethiopia is uniquely challenging due to a critical Information Gap." Founders often struggle with three major obstacles: 1. Regulatory Complexity: Navigating National Bank of Ethiopia (NBE) directives, sector-specific proclamations, and the new Startup Proclamation is often a manual, confusing process that requires expensive legal counsel. 2. Lack of Localized Data: Generic AI models and global benchmarks do not reflect the Ethiopian reality—from Akaki warehouse rents and Bole office costs to local smartphone penetration and mobile money adoption rates. 3. Execution Uncertainty: Founders often lack a "high-conviction" roadmap, leading to wasted capital on business models that aren't legally viable or operationally grounded in the local context. JemirUp is a specialized intelligence platform designed to bridge this gap. It solves these problems through three core pillars: 1. High-Conviction Startup Validation: JemirUp doesn't just give generic advice. It uses a proprietary scoring engine to analyze a startup idea across five dimensions: Market Viability, Regulatory Compliance, Unit Economics, Innovation Angle, and Execution Complexity. It provides founders with a deep-dive analysis, identifying "red flags" early—such as foreign investment restrictions or minimum capital requirements—before they spend a single Birr. 2. The Research Studio (Localized RAG): Powered by advanced "Retrieval-Augmented Generation" (RAG), our Research Studio is seeded with a verified library of Ethiopian policies, strategies, rule and regulations, directives, and development plans (like Digital Ethiopia 2030). 3. Localized Benchmarking & Unit Economics: The platform is grounded in real-world Ethiopian numbers.
